The largest retailer of agricultural inputs and implements

Why Farm & City
Farm and City is the preferred countrywide retail outlet offering retail agricultural inputs, building materials and general hardware across the nation.

Farm and City Centre is the largest retailer of agricultural inputs and implements through its network of 36 retail outlets in urban and farming areas: a one stop shop for all agricultural, building material and general hardware requirements.

Our flagship branch is the 2,000 m² Harare Hardware situated at the corner of Fourth Street and Kenneth Kaunda Avenue in Harare. Enjoying abundant parking space this flagship brand retails general hardware, agricultural inputs, veterinary products and building material.

What started as a Farmers’ Co-operative in the then city of Salisbury on 21 March 1908 has become the biggest farming inputs and implements retailer in Zimbabwe measured by number of branches.



Essentially established for the benefit of the maize grower, the Farmer’s Co-op made trading practical and advanced finance when the maize was delivered, or provided credit to members when in need. The Farmers’ Co-op operated as a co-operative till 1919 and thereafter became a limited liability company.
The Farmers’ Co-op Limited Company was incorporated on 26 February 1919. The Maize Control Act of 1931 removed the marketing of maize from co-operatives and traders and placed it in the hands of a Maize Control Board. The Farmer’ Co-op ceased to be responsible for selling members’ maize both on the home and overseas market. What then seemed to be the way to go and revive the business was to reorganize the store into two departments, groceries and farm produce.

The buying department established in 1937 undertook the task of assisting farmers to deal with the problems of obtaining fertilizer, seeds, equipment and other necessary inputs. The company was later registered in 1953 and a re-organisation was carried out in October 1989 with the formation of Consolidated Farming Investments, which became the owner of most of the properties and investments previously owned by farmers’ Co-op.

In 1995, it was agreed that Consolidated Farming Investments would buy the farmers’ Co-op trading division which was to trade in future as the Farm and City Centre (FCC).

Our milestones

The Farmers’ Co-op grew from strength to strength. It opened branches in all the successful farming regions and this saw the Farmers’ Co-op as the only company in Salisbury that supported the agricultural activities in the country.

  • 1947 - 1982: Opening of 10 countrywide branches;
  • 1989: Reorganization was carried out during October 1989 with the formation of Consolidated Farming Investments (CFI Holdings);
  • 1995: Consolidated Farming Investments (CFI) bought the farmers’ Co-op trading division which was to trade in future as the Farm and City Centre (FCC);
  • 2010: FCC opened Hauna, Odzi, and Mutoko branches;
  • 2011: To date Farm and City Centre has 36 branches across Zimbabwe.
FCC’s key suppliers are leading and reputable manufacturers in their areas of specialization including but not limited to top seed companies, building product manufacturers, stock feed manufacturers, leading fertilizer companies and cement manufacturers.

We support over 300 rural agro-dealers

FCC actively assists over 300 agro-dealers in remote and rural areas by providing products on consignment to small dealers for resale, at no cost, to encourage entrepreneurship and promote brand outreach. We further assist the agro-dealers with business training programmes in collaboration with non-governmental organisations.

FCC donates various products to a number of individuals and institutions upon request.
